Sinking Foundation Repair in Browns Mills, NJ
Sinking foundation repair services address issues related to the gradual settling or shifting of a property's foundation, which can lead to uneven floors, cracked walls, and other structural concerns. These projects typically involve assessing the extent of foundation movement and implementing stabilization methods such as underpinning, piering, or mudjacking to restore stability and prevent further damage. Homeowners often seek this service when they notice signs like sticking doors, cracked drywall, or uneven flooring, aiming to protect the integrity of their property and maintain safety.

Common Sinking Foundation Repair Jobs
Foundation Underpinning - stabilizes and strengthens sinking foundations to prevent further movement.
Pier and Beam Repair - raises and supports sagging or uneven floors caused by foundation settling.
Slab Jacking - lifts sunken concrete slabs to restore level surfaces and prevent tripping hazards.
Wall Stabilization - reinforces cracked or bowing basement and foundation walls for added stability.
Drainage Solutions - improves water flow around the foundation to reduce soil erosion and shifting.
Soil Stabilization - addresses soil movement beneath the foundation to prevent future sinking issues.
Sinking Foundation Repair Questions
What are signs of a sinking foundation? Common signs include u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around the foundation.
How does sinking foundation repair work? Repair methods often involve stabilization techniques like underpinning or piering to restore stability and level the structure.
Can sinking foundations cause structural damage? Yes, ongoing settlement can lead to cracks, bowing walls, and other structural issues if not addressed.
